<p>I gathered info about all the past 4-5 tests to see curves. etc.
I will be putting paranthesis after to show you its comparison to the blue book range so if i say + 30 that means its 30 + the avg. range in the blue book.
October.
Writing - 11 E 42 = 710 (kinda harsh)
January
CR - 39 = 560 (0)
Math - 52 = 780 (20+)
Writing = 37 , 8E = 600 (very harsh.. 65-)
April
CR - 58 = 700 (+10)
Math = 47 = 690 (0)
Writing = kinda iffy (didnt get straight answer) (0)
April again
CR = 53 (660) (+20)
W = 33 12 E (640) (-40)
May
CR - 49 = 630 (10+)
Math - 52 = (760) (0)
Writing = 41 (outta 48) 9E = 690 (the avg.)
May again
CR - 55 = 680 (10+)
M 48 (700) = (0)
W - 12E 41 = 740 (0)
June
CR - 61 = 750 (+30)
Math = 52 = 750 (-10)
Writing = 45 6E = 660 (-30)</p>

<p>Ok this is what I gathered
It shows that CR in the last 5 tests has NEVER had lower than the avg. The lowest its been was the exact middle. Writing... its been getting steadily better but is still a bit harsh. math is just about middle.</p>

<p>So Don't worry about CR too much. Curve is usually good.</p>
